要成为网络设计师,需要系统学习专业知识、掌握核心工具、积累实践经验,并持续关注行业动态,以下是具体路径和关键能力培养方向:

基础理论与技术储备
网络设计的核心是理解网络架构与数据传输逻辑,需先掌握以下基础:
- 网络协议与模型:深入学习TCP/IP协议族(HTTP/HTTPS、FTP、DNS等)、OSI七层模型与TCP/IP四层模型的对应关系,理解数据封装与解封装过程。
- 网络设备原理:掌握路由器、交换机、防火墙、负载均衡器等设备的功能与工作原理,例如VLAN划分、路由协议(OSPF、BGP)、ACL访问控制策略等。
- 网络拓扑设计:学习星型、树型、网状等拓扑结构的优缺点,能够根据业务需求(如企业网、数据中心、物联网)选择合适架构,并考虑冗余备份、扩展性与安全性。
核心工具与技能掌握
网络设计需借助工具实现可视化与方案落地,重点掌握以下技能:
- 绘图与原型工具:
- 专业工具:使用Visio、Lucidchart绘制网络拓扑图、逻辑架构图,标注设备型号、IP规划、链路带宽等关键信息。
- 原型工具:通过Axure、Figma设计网络管理界面、用户交互原型,提升方案的可理解性。
- 网络模拟与测试工具:
- 使用Packet Tracer、GNS3进行网络模拟,验证路由策略、VLAN间通信等设计方案的可行性;
- 通过Wireshark抓包分析数据传输过程,排查潜在故障。
- 自动化与编程能力:
- 学习Python结合Netmiko、Paramiko库实现设备配置自动化;
- 了解Ansible等配置管理工具,提升大规模网络部署效率。
行业规范与项目实践
- 遵循行业标准:熟悉IEEE 802系列标准(如Wi-Fi 802.11ac)、RFC技术文档,以及ISO 27001信息安全管理体系,确保设计方案合规。
- 参与真实项目:
- 从中小型企业网络设计入手,完成需求分析(如用户数量、带宽需求)、IP地址规划(VLSM子网划分)、设备选型(华为、思科、华三等品牌)到方案文档编写全流程;
- 尝试设计高可用架构(如HSRP/VRRP网关冗余、链路聚合),或SDN软件定义网络方案,结合OpenFlow协议实现灵活流量控制。
持续学习与职业发展
- 认证提升竞争力:考取CCNA/CCNP(思科)、HCIP/HCIE(华为)、JNCIA/JNCIP(瞻博)等认证,系统化知识体系。
- 关注技术前沿:研究5G网络切片、边缘计算、零信任架构等新兴技术,探索其在智慧城市、工业互联网中的应用场景。
- 软技能培养:提升需求沟通能力(向客户解读技术方案)、文档撰写能力(设计方案、测试报告)、团队协作能力(与开发、运维团队配合)。
相关问答FAQs
Q1:非计算机专业背景如何转行成为网络设计师?
A1:可通过在线课程(如Coursera《计算机网络》专项课程)、考取入门级认证(如CCNA)建立基础;参与开源项目(如OpenStack网络组件开发)或实习积累经验;利用Python等工具弥补编程短板,逐步从网络运维过渡到设计岗位。
Q2:网络设计师与网络工程师的区别是什么?
A2:网络设计师侧重“规划与设计”,负责需求分析、架构方案制定、技术选型,需具备较强的系统思维与文档能力;网络工程师侧重“实施与运维”,负责设备配置、故障排查、性能优化,更关注实操技能,两者常需协作,设计师前期方案需工程师落地验证。

